Android アプリケーションの自動サスペンドを設定することは可能ですか? これは、ログイン パスワードが 6 回以上間違って入力された場合に一時停止できるアプリケーションを作成することを目的としています。これはセキュリティ上の目的のためであり、ユーザーはアプリケーションを使用できなくなります。この考えの背後にある理由は、スマートフォンのアイデアは、不正なユーザーによるアクセスであるか、スマートフォンが盗まれた疑いがあるためです。
質問する
4324 次
1 に答える
0
SharedPreferencesを使用して、ログイン試行を追跡し、ログインActivity
が開始されるたびにこの値を確認できます。それが 6 の場合、または選択した任意の数の場合はDialog
、ユーザーに問題と修正方法 (またはそれを処理したい方法) を通知するメッセージを表示します。では、クリックするとアプリケーションを閉じるDialog
ものを持つことができます(それを呼び出すだけです.Button
finish()
Activity
ログインが失敗するたびに、その前の値に 1 を追加するだけですSharedPreference
。
これが必要でない場合は、CommonsWare が言ったように、「「サスペンド」の意味を定義してください」
于 2013-07-27T15:47:48.750 に答える